One Direction have already broken records with their new music and their album Four hasn’t even been released yet!

The band has hit the number one spot on iTunes in 67 countries with their new album, two months before its official release.

On top of that, the band’s single Fireproof which was put up as a free download, has now broken records, becoming the most downloaded free track in history. It was downloaded a whopping 1,089,287 times in the 24-hour window that it was available.

 

After the band’s announcement earlier this week that their new music was available for pre-order, the album zoomed straight to the number one spot in nearly 70 countries including the USA, the UK, Spain and India.

The new album has also been the subject of more than 1.7 million tweets.

The news comes just days after it was announced that the band had entered this year’s Guinness Book of Records for being the ‘First Act to Debut at No. 1 with first three albums’ . This came as a result of the success of Midnight MemoriesUp All Night and Take Me Home. 

Four will not be released until November 17th.
